Title :
Strategic Transfer Pricing for Products/Services under Oligopoly

Abstract :
This paper analyzes the use of transfer pricing as a strategic device in divisional firms facing duopolistic price competition. We suppose that the firms confront the oligopoly intermediate products/services market and final products/service market. By comparing two transfer pricing policy: uniform transfer pricing and discriminating transfer pricing, we conclude that if the price of intermediate product in internal and external market is equal, then the transfer price should be marginal cost plus; if the headquarters set discriminating price in internal and external intermediate markets, the transfer price will rise. Meanwhile, the profit of the total firms and the downstream divisions will also increase
